Bad client

Hi,

I worked with this client once, on our first project. Back then, since he doesn't know how long the video will be, I said that we could set a milestone for 2-minute video, and then add another once the clip is done. It turns out more than 3 minutes.

After receiving my video, he said that my work is not good enough for 250$ per minute, so he only paid 500$ for more than 3 minutes and refuse to pay the rest ~300 dollars. It's my fault though that I trusted him and didn't set the full amount milestone before working. After arguing, I decided to move on. The story of the first project ends here.

After a few months, he came back and said that he agreed with my price, and insisted I work with him again. I agreed.

I sent him some full scenes that have the characters. He feedbacked on some other details.

I made the whole video and sent him. He refused to pay and said that the characters are not ok and claimed that I hired another artist to work on it, so that it doesn't look like the characters in our first video!

I don't know what to do, but I think that maybe my style has changed a bit since last month, so I took the puppets from our last video to edit on them and sent him the new characters.

Again, he claimed that "Hello, the characters are still not ok. I will send feedback". 4 days later, he said that the characters still don't have the same style as our last video.

What should I do now?
